Transaction 6e8823f1a63b36ad788c811040331a10479aac0f45bb81139b96ee2736163be8
1 Input
1 Output
-
6e8823f1a63b36ad788c811040331a10479aac0f45bb81139b96ee2736163be8:0
- value
- 1013317
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5a7b3f7d1e3b7f4a856404cf36a197f71f6de94
- address
- bc1q6knm8a73uwmlf2zkgpx0x6se0acldh555cescp